Best Nevada Private Schools Offering Swimming Sport (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 8 private schools offering swimming as an interscholastic sport serving 6,427 students in Nevada.
The top ranked offering swimming sport private schools in Nevada include The Adelson Educational Campus-las Vegas, Bishop Manogue Catholic High School and Faith Lutheran Middle School & High School.
The average acceptance rate is 81%, which is lower than the Nevada private school average acceptance rate of 86%.
50% of private schools offering swimming sport in Nevada are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Jewish).
